perf metrics: Don't add all tool events for sharing

Tool events are added to the set of events for parsing so that having a
tool event in a metric doesn't inhibit event sharing of events between
metrics.

All tool events were added but this meant unused tool events would be
counted. Reduce this set of tool events to just those present in the
overall metric list.
